Warning Signs You Need Smoke Damage Cleanup
Catching smoke damage early can save you a lot of trouble down the line. Ignoring the signs can lead to permanent staining, deeply embedded odors, and potential health issues. It’s important to recognize what to look for so you can act quickly. We’re here to help you identify these issues around your property.
Lingering Smoke Odors
A faint smell of smoke that doesn’t dissipate after a few days is a clear sign. These odors can come from microscopic soot particles embedded in carpets, upholstery, and even drywall. Persistent odors need professional attention.
Visible Soot or Ash Residue
Even small fires can leave a fine layer of soot on surfaces. You might notice a greasy film on walls, furniture, or appliances. This residue is not only unsightly but can also be corrosive over time. Soot removal requires specific techniques.
Discolored Surfaces
Smoke can cause yellowing or darkening of walls, ceilings, and fabrics. This discoloration often indicates that soot has penetrated the material. Surface discoloration is a visual cue of smoke damage.
Musty or Chemical Smells
Sometimes, smoke damage can manifest as a musty or even a chemical-like odor, especially if the fire involved synthetic materials. These unusual smells signal that harmful compounds may be present. Unusual smells are a warning.
Damage to Belongings
Your personal items, from clothing to furniture, can absorb smoke odors and become stained. If your belongings smell strongly of smoke or have visible residue, they likely need professional cleaning. Restoring personal items is part of the process.
Smoke Damage Cleanup v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Light surface soot on hard, non-porous surfaces (like sealed countertops) | Yes | No | Easy to wipe down with appropriate cleaners. |
| Strong, pervasive smoke odor throughout the entire house | No | Yes | Professional equipment is needed to neutralize odors at the source. |
| Visible soot or charring on walls, ceilings, or carpets | No | Yes | Requires specialized cleaning agents and methods to avoid spreading or setting stains. |
| Smoke damage to electronics or sensitive equipment | No | Yes | Requires expert knowledge to clean without causing further damage or electrical hazards. |
| Minor, localized smoke smell after a small contained incident (e.g., burnt toast) | Yes | No | Often resolves with good ventilation and cleaning of the immediate area. |
| Significant smoke damage after a house fire, even if small | No | Yes | Involves deep penetration into materials and potential structural issues. |
While simple ventilation and wiping down surfaces might help with very minor smoke incidents, anything more significant demands professional attention. Smoke Damage Cleanup Cost In Bellevue, WA
The cost of smoke damage cleanup in Bellevue, WA, can vary significantly. Factors like the size of the affected area, the type and intensity of the smoke, the materials damaged, and the extent of odor penetration all play a role. These price ranges are estimates to give you a general idea of potential costs.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Inspection and Assessment | $200 – $600 | Complexity of the fire and the number of areas to inspect. |
| Soot and Residue Cleaning (per room) | $500 – $2,000 | Surface types (porous vs. non-porous) and the density of soot. |
| Odor Neutralization (e.g., Ozone Treatment) | $750 – $3,000 | Size of the property and the severity of the odor. |
| Content Cleaning and Restoration (per item) | $100 – $1,000+ | Type of item, material, and the extent of smoke damage. |
| HVAC System Cleaning | $500 – $1,500 | Number of vents and the overall complexity of the ductwork. |
| Emergency Board-Up/Securing Property | $300 – $1,000 | Extent of damage requiring temporary repairs. |

What is the difference between wet smoke and dry smoke damage?
Wet smoke, often from smoldering fires, is sticky, gummy, and has a strong odor. It causes significant staining and is harder to remove. Dry smoke, from fast-burning fires, is powdery and can travel further into the building. Understanding the smoke type dictates the cleaning strategy. Our technicians are trained to identify both and apply the correct treatment.
